Tony F Dordogne Posted September 9, 2006 Share Posted September 9, 2006 A chum got himself into a bit of a scrape (was over the limit) a few weeks ago and had his licence pulled by the Prefecture.His three months is up today - he's been for the tests which he passed easily, hasn't had a drink again and was told he would get his licence back because there was no reason to hold on to it.Does anybody know what the process is for the return of the licence? Does it just appear at his home, the local G men/women's office or does he have to go get it from Perigeaux?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Sunday Driver Posted September 10, 2006 Share Posted September 10, 2006 The avis de retention that he was given when he surrendered his licence shows the address of the office he needs to contact in order to get it back. The office will make his licence available for collection up to midday following the date the retention period expired. After that, he has to send a request by registered post (with accuse de reception).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
